ABSTRACT:
A rate controller in run-level domain transcoder, which receives a stream of compressed frames carried in a bit stream, selectively determines whether to quantize and/or threshold portions of a frame carried in the stream of frames. The rate controller determines the input size of the frame and based at least in part upon at least a desired size, requantizes and/or thresholds the frame such that the output size of the frame is approximately the desired size.
